The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y typically has a medium to large build, with a muscular and athletic frame. Their coat is often a mix of colors, including black, brown, and white, and may have a speckled or mottled appearance. Their eyes are typically striking and expressive, with shades of blue, brown, or hazel.
One of the most distinctive features of the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y is their coat, which is typically thick and water-resistant, making them well-suited for a variety of climates. They may have a short, smooth coat like the Lab, or a longer, wavier coat like the Australian Shepherd. In either case, regular grooming is necessary to keep their coat healthy and free of tangles.
The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y is known for their intelligence, loyalty, and high energy levels. They are extremely active and thrive on physical and mental stimulation, making them perfect for families who en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, running, or playing fetch. They are also highly trainable, thanks to their keen intelligence and eagerness to please.
Despite their high energy levels, the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y is also known for their gentle and affectionate nature. They are great with children and other pets, making them an ideal family dog. However, they may exhibit herding instincts inherited from their Australian Shepherd parent, so early socialization and training are essential to ensure they coexist peacefully with other animals.
Due to their high energy levels and intelligence, the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y requires plenty of exercise and mental stimulation to prevent boredom and destructive behavior. Daily walks, runs, and playtime are essential to keep them happy and healthy. They also excel in obedience training and agility competitions, thanks to their natural athleticism and eagerness to learn.
Consistent training and positive reinforcement are key to raising a well-behaved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y. They respond well to commands and enjoy learning new tricks, so training sessions can be a fun and rewarding experience for both dog and owner. It's important to be patient and consistent in your approach, as these dogs thrive on routine and structure.
Like all dogs, the Australian Shepherd Lab Mix with Blue Lacy is susceptible to certain health issues, including hip dysplasia, obesity, and eye problems. Regular veterinary check-ups, a balanced diet, and plenty of exercise are essential to keeping them healthy and happy. It's also important to provide regular grooming to keep their coat in good condition and prevent matting.
